Abstract

The utility model belongs to the field of feed production, and particularly relates to a mixing device for fish feed production, which comprises an equipment shell, wherein fixed plates are symmetrically fixed on the top of an inner cavity of the equipment shell, the two fixed plates are respectively and rotatably connected with a connecting rod a, an annular plate is jointly fixed between the two connecting rods a, a motor a is fixed on the top of the equipment shell, an output end of the motor a is fixedly connected with a special-shaped rotating shaft, the lower end of the special-shaped rotating shaft is fixedly connected with a motor b, the front wall and the rear wall of the annular plate are respectively and rotatably connected with a connecting rod b, the other ends of the two connecting rods b are respectively and fixedly connected with a motor b, and an output end of the motor b is provided with a stirring mechanism through a rotating shaft. The utility model realizes multi-angle stirring and free assembly and disassembly of the blades, and is convenient to clean.

Description

Mixing arrangement for fish feed production
Technical Field
The utility model relates to the field of feed production devices, in particular to a mixing device for fish feed production.
Background
The fish feed is a feed for fish as its name implies, its main components are protein, fat, vitamins and mineral substances, the protein is an important nutrient for fish and shrimp, and is an important constituent for forming organism cell, tissue and organ, and when feeding, several feeds are mixed, so that it is favourable for providing fish herd with balanced nutrients.
The feed stirring device for fish culture used at present is difficult to crush hard and large feed into blocks, and the feed after stirring is not uniform enough, which is not beneficial to fish to eat.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ments.
Referring to fig. 1-5, a mixing arrangement for fish feed production, including equipment casing 1, the inner chamber top symmetry of equipment casing 1 is fixed with fixed plate 3, two fixed plates 3 all rotate and are connected with connecting rod a4, be fixed with annular plate 6 between two connecting rod a4 jointly, the top of equipment casing 1 is fixed with motor a7, the output fixedly connected with dysmorphism pivot 8 of motor a7, the shape of dysmorphism pivot 8 comprises L shape pivot and oblique pivot, the effect of dysmorphism pivot 8 can make drives motor b9 slope rotation through motor a7, the lower extreme fixedly connected with motor b9 of dysmorphism pivot 8, the front and back wall of annular plate 6 all rotates and is connected with connecting rod b10, the other end of two connecting rod b10 all with motor b9 fixed connection, the output of motor b9 is provided with rabbling mechanism through rotatory pivot 11.
In an alternative example, the stirring mechanism comprises a stirring shaft 12 fixed on a rotating shaft 11, the stirring shaft 12 is detachably provided with a ring 13, the ring 13 is fixed on the stirring shaft 12 through a screw 15, and the ring 13 is provided with a stirring blade 14.
In an alternative example, the feeding channel 2 is symmetrically fixed on the top of the equipment shell 1, a filter screen 16 fixed on the fixed plate 3 and the inner wall of the equipment shell 1 is arranged below the feeding channel 2, and the feed is fed into the equipment shell 1 through the feeding channel 2 and is filtered through the filter screen 16.
In an alternative example, the bottom of the device housing 1 is provided with several support legs 17.
In an alternative example, a discharge channel 18 is fixedly communicated with the bottom of the device shell 1, a switch valve 19 is arranged in the discharge channel 18, and the discharge channel 18 and the switch valve 19 are arranged to conveniently discharge the feed in the device shell 1.
In an alternative example, the front side of the apparatus casing 1 is provided with a door 20.
The working principle is as follows:
opening the bin gate 20, sleeving the ring connected with the stirring blades 14 upwards from the lower end of the stirring shaft 12, and then locking and fixing the ring on the stirring shaft 12 by using the screw 15; the feed is put into the feeding channel 2, the filter screen 16 primarily filters the feed, the motor b9 is turned on, the motor 9 operates to drive the rotating shaft 11 to rotate, the rotating shaft 11 rotates to drive the stirring shaft 12 to rotate, and the rotating shaft 12 rotates to drive the stirring blades 14 to rotate; the motor a7 is started, the motor a7 operates to drive the special-shaped rotating shaft 8 to rotate, the special-shaped rotating shaft 8 rotates to drive the motor b9 to rotate in the annular plate 6, and meanwhile, the annular plate 6 moves integrally, so that the stirring is multi-angle, and the defect of the traditional single-angle stirring is overcome.
